6 Ways Small Businesses Can Reduce Overhead Cost

If you are looking to make your small business more cost-effective and efficient, there are six simple adjustments you can make to reduce expenditure and time-wasting. From taking advantage of modern technology to changing business utility providers, you will be saving money in no time.

Take a look at this list and see how many, if any, of these positive steps your business has taken to be more economical.

1&2. Take Advantage of Technology

There are endless ways small businesses can use technology to make their work more efficient, cost-effective, and straightforward, but two top tips are to use free internet calling services and set up an automated chatbot.

1. Free Video Calling Platforms

Technology doesn’t have to be complicated and overwhelming. Chances are in your personal life you are already using the technology that can save your business money. Using Whatsapp or Skype to make internet audio or video calls can save your company a lot of money on VoIP technology. These platforms are great for group communication, they’re easy to use, and they don’t cost a thing!

2. Automated Chatbot

An automated chatbot on your website can reduce the need for customer service personnel, while also providing instant answers for clients with frequently asked questions (FAQs). The bot can choose an appropriate response to simple queries from a catalog of readily available answers. This cuts down on the volume of calls and emails your company will receive, meaning less time and manpower spent on customer services.

3. Reduce Utility Prices

Changing your business electricity provider is one simple way you can make savings, but a lot of companies don’t think of it. In fact, many business owners don’t receive or don’t remember receiving a renewal letter from their electricity provider, so they continue paying too much without looking at the alternatives. 

Roughly one in three businesses are in a position to change electricity providers, they just don’t know it. Provided you don’t have debt with your current supplier, and you give the appropriate notice, you can compare business utility prices online and find a better deal for your company. 4. Cut Down On Office Space

In the past couple of years, it has been much more normalised and accepted that many businesses have a lot of remote workers. If your company can run effectively with some staff working from home, this is a great way to cut down on office space, which is a significant cost reduction.

You can further reduce office space with the next top tip.

5. Go Paperless

Moving to a paperless system will eliminate the need for file storage space, allowing you to downsize your office further. Moreover, without the cost of paper, ink, and mailing supplies, you have another easy decrease in spending.

Transition to a digital billing and invoice system, store all files on a computer, and only print when necessary. Once you have transitioned to a paperless system, you won’t look back. Files will be easier to find, your billing and invoicing will be faster, trips to the post box and supply stores eliminated, and to top it off, you’ll be saving money.

With the help from some paper-saving apps, you can still write notes easily, save receipts and mark your calendar, all while eliminating paper from your business life. 

6. Buy Second Hand

While it can be tempting to fill your office with shiny new gadgets and top-of-the-line equipment, a massive cost saver is buying refurbished furniture and equipment that is still good quality. Despite being used, these items should be functional, practical, and efficient, but offered by manufacturers at a discounted price.
